INTEGRITY
Wikipedia defines
integrity as:
consistency of actions, values, methods, measures, principles,
expectations and outcome. As a holistic concept, it judges the quality of a
system in terms of its ability to achieve its own goals. A value system's abstraction
depth and range of applicable interaction may also function as significant
factors in identifying integrity due to their congruence or lack of congruence
with empirical observation. A value system may evolve over time while retaining
integrity if those who espouse the values account for and resolve
inconsistencies. Integrity may be seen as the quality of having a sense of
honesty and truthfulness in regard to the motivations for one's actions.
